How Pat Burrell's Inning Played Compares to Similar Players

Pat Burrell totaled 11,292 career Inning Played, well above the league average of 2,296.8 — a mark that ranked among the best of his era. His best Inning Played season came in 2002, posting 1,383, well above the league average of 336.8 that year. The lowest point came in 2009 at 9, well below the league average of 318.5 that year. The Inning Played trended upward through the final seasons. The Inning Played total went from 9 in 2009 to 632 in 2010 and 349 in 2011, rising over the span. The upward arc continued through his final campaign. Significant season-to-season variance characterizes the Inning Played profile — ranging from 9 to 1,383 — though the career average remained well above league norms.
